/src/sys/dev/pci/cxgb/ |
cxgb_ael1002.c | 144 void t3_ael1002_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, 147 cphy_init(phy, adapter, phy_addr, &ael1002_ops, mdio_ops); 217 void t3_ael1006_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, 220 cphy_init(phy, adapter, phy_addr, &ael1006_ops, mdio_ops); 252 void t3_qt2045_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, 257 cphy_init(phy, adapter, phy_addr, &qt2045_ops, mdio_ops); 263 if (!phy_addr && !mdio_read(phy, MDIO_DEV_PMA_PMD, MII_BMSR, &stat) && 329 void t3_xaui_direct_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, 332 cphy_init(phy, adapter, phy_addr, &xaui_direct_ops, mdio_ops);
|
cxgb_common.h | 139 int (*read)(adapter_t *adapter, int phy_addr, int mmd_addr, 141 int (*write)(adapter_t *adapter, int phy_addr, int mmd_addr, 159 void (*phy_prep)(struct cphy *phy, adapter_t *adapter, int phy_addr, 535 int (*mdio_read)(adapter_t *adapter, int phy_addr, int mmd_addr, 537 int (*mdio_write)(adapter_t *adapter, int phy_addr, int mmd_addr, 556 int phy_addr, struct cphy_ops *phy_ops, 560 phy->addr = phy_addr; 773 void t3_mv88e1xxx_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, 775 void t3_vsc8211_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, 777 void t3_ael1002_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, [all...] |
cxgb_vsc8211.c | 247 void t3_vsc8211_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, 250 cphy_init(phy, adapter, phy_addr, &vsc8211_ops, mdio_ops);
|
cxgb_mv88e1xxx.c | 292 void t3_mv88e1xxx_phy_prep(struct cphy *phy, adapter_t *adapter, int phy_addr, 295 cphy_init(phy, adapter, phy_addr, &mv88e1xxx_ops, mdio_ops);
|
cxgb_t3_hw.c | 214 static int mi1_read(adapter_t *adapter, int phy_addr, int mmd_addr, 218 u32 addr = V_REGADDR(reg_addr) | V_PHYADDR(phy_addr); 233 static int mi1_write(adapter_t *adapter, int phy_addr, int mmd_addr, 237 u32 addr = V_REGADDR(reg_addr) | V_PHYADDR(phy_addr); 259 static int mi1_ext_read(adapter_t *adapter, int phy_addr, int mmd_addr, 263 u32 addr = V_REGADDR(mmd_addr) | V_PHYADDR(phy_addr); 281 static int mi1_ext_write(adapter_t *adapter, int phy_addr, int mmd_addr, 285 u32 addr = V_REGADDR(mmd_addr) | V_PHYADDR(phy_addr);
|
/src/sys/arch/mips/cavium/dev/ |
octeon_smi.c | 195 octsmi_read(struct octsmi_softc *sc, int phy_addr, int reg, uint16_t *val) 202 __SHIFTIN(phy_addr, SMI_CMD_PHY_ADR) | 223 octsmi_write(struct octsmi_softc *sc, int phy_addr, int reg, uint16_t value) 234 __SHIFTIN(phy_addr, SMI_CMD_PHY_ADR) | 249 phy_addr, reg, value);
|
if_cnmac.c | 435 cnmac_mii_readreg(device_t self, int phy_addr, int reg, uint16_t *val) 439 return octsmi_read(sc->sc_smi, phy_addr, reg, val); 443 cnmac_mii_writereg(device_t self, int phy_addr, int reg, uint16_t val) 447 return octsmi_write(sc->sc_smi, phy_addr, reg, val);
|
/src/sys/arch/mips/ralink/ |
ralink_eth.c | 1682 ralink_eth_mii_read(device_t self, int phy_addr, int phy_reg, uint16_t *val) 1687 printf("%s() phy_addr: %d phy_reg: %d\n", __func__, phy_addr, phy_reg); 1690 if (phy_addr > 5) 1714 PCTL0_RD_CMD | PCTL0_REG(phy_reg) | PCTL0_ADDR(phy_addr)); 1717 MDIO_ACCESS_PHY_ADDR(phy_addr) | MDIO_ACCESS_REG(phy_reg)); 1719 MDIO_ACCESS_PHY_ADDR(phy_addr) | MDIO_ACCESS_REG(phy_reg) | 1750 ralink_eth_mii_write(device_t self, int phy_addr, int phy_reg, uint16_t val) 1755 printf("%s() phy_addr: %d phy_reg: %d val: 0x%04x\n", 1756 __func__, phy_addr, phy_reg, val) [all...] |
/src/sys/dev/pci/ixgbe/ |
ixgbe_phy.c | 290 * @phy_addr: PHY address to probe 294 static bool ixgbe_probe_phy(struct ixgbe_hw *hw, u16 phy_addr) 298 if (!ixgbe_validate_phy_addr(hw, phy_addr)) { 300 phy_addr); 332 u16 phy_addr; local in function:ixgbe_identify_phy_generic 347 phy_addr = (hw->phy.nw_mng_if_sel & 350 if (ixgbe_probe_phy(hw, phy_addr)) 356 for (phy_addr = 0; phy_addr < IXGBE_MAX_PHY_ADDR; phy_addr++) [all...] |
ixgbe_phy.h | 163 bool ixgbe_validate_phy_addr(struct ixgbe_hw *hw, u32 phy_addr);
|
/src/sys/dev/pci/ |
if_bge.c | 2044 int phy_addr = 1; local in function:bge_phy_addr 2072 phy_addr = pa->pa_function; 2074 phy_addr += (CSR_READ_4(sc, BGE_SGDIG_STS) & 2077 phy_addr += (CSR_READ_4(sc, BGE_CPMU_PHY_STRAP) & 2082 return phy_addr;
|
/src/sys/dev/ic/ |
advlib.c | 1132 u_int32_t phy_addr; local in function:AscInitMicroCodeVar 1145 phy_addr = (sc->overrun_buf & 0xfffffff8) + 8; 1146 AscWriteLramDWord(iot, ioh, ASCV_OVERRUN_PADDR_D, phy_addr);
|